The Answer:
There are 2 pints in 4 cups.
Understanding the Conversion:
This conversion is based on the fundamental relationship between cups and pints in the US customary system of measurement:
- 1 pint = 2 cups
Therefore, to find the number of pints in 4 cups, you simply divide the number of cups by 2:
4 cups / 2 cups/pint = 2 pints

Beyond 4 Cups: Mastering Cup to Pint Conversions:
To confidently handle different volumes, remember the basic rule: divide the number of cups by 2 to get the equivalent number of pints. For example:
- 6 cups = 3 pints (6 / 2 = 3)
- 8 cups = 4 pints (8 / 2 = 4)
- 10 cups = 5 pints (10 / 2 = 5)
